This is as up to date as it gets. The CMP forum is not the place for CMP sales policy info.
http://thecmp.org/cmp_sales/1911-information/
I suspect this is the most important part of the whole thing.
"Every applicant will be treated as a new customer to CMP.
CMP 1911 is an FFL governed operation and is a separate entity from CMP and has its own record keeping operation with no ties to the existing CMP records."
Not as important as this though.
"Orders must be postmarked NOT PRIOR TO 4 September 2018 and NOT AFTER 4 October 2018."

A number of the International Harvester M1 Rifles were sent to other countries as foreign-aid, but Harry Truman cancelled Lend-Lease almost as soon as WWII ended.

Iran received two groups of M1 Garands in 1963 (66,493 and 99,000). In 1966 Iran received 32 M1Ds. It is said that Iran received a lot of IHC Garands.

Here is a list of countries that received M1s under the Military Assistance Program (MAP):
